    Aug 26, 2023 · It is a modified Kiev-class aircraft carrier which entered into service with the Indian Navy in 2013. It has been renamed in honour of Vikramaditya, a legendary emperor of Ujjain, India. The carrier served with the Soviet Navy and later with the Russian Navy (as Admiral Gorshkov) before being decommissioned in 1996.

  10. INS Vikramaditya is a flagship of the Indian Navy, in service from 2013. It was originally a Russian Kiev-Class ship before being modified into a full-fledged aircraft carrier after its purchase by India. She was commissioned on 16 November 2013 at a ceremony held at Severodvinsk, Russia.
